I've done LT and S&S. I find S&S far easier to stick to as the products are actually enjoyable, plus the protein and veg option really helps me both to stick to it and to learn about portion sizes and choosing lower calorie things for later on. I hated all but the LT chocolate shake so spent 16 weeks on chocolate shakes only (this was 7 years ago). That was very hard and after 16 weeks I couldn't do it anymore. I've been on S&S far longer (starting to step up now). My weight loss was better on LT BUT I was bad and didn't have all of my packs as I hated them so couldn't be bothered to have them all quite often. With S&S I have always had all of my packs and obviously that's far healthier. I know I couldn't do LT again, but I could see myself doing S&S again if I had to. I even plan to use some of the products in maintenance.
